INDIANAPOLIS — Indiana Fever star Caitlin Clark will miss the rest of the 2025 WNBA season, including a potential playoff appearance, due to injury.

Clark announced the news on social media Thursday night. She hasn't played since injuring her right groin in the final minute of the Fever's July 15 win at Connecticut.

She also suffered a bone bruise later during her recovery.
